He is also heard on interim relief. By placing reliance on (2003) 8 SCC 565 (M.Anasuya Devi and another Vs. M. Manik Reddy and others), it is submitted that the court below has erred in holding that in execution proceeding objection of judgment debtor can not be entertained.
Considering the aforesaid, till next date of hearing the further proceeding of EX AB 62/2018 pending before the court of Principal Judge, District Burhanpur shall remain stayed.
